Output c604898c6ccd0d30f1ddcacc92edc506c75c8fceb8a62d11a54c67df3bd7ea13:80

value
43055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b75c81e09c1d6a4ffb7d5660f903f562469f1ce OP_EQUAL
address
35ep5QgDZWcxRjKwLpKEY3ZGqepVxCPK9n
transaction
c604898c6ccd0d30f1ddcacc92edc506c75c8fceb8a62d11a54c67df3bd7ea13
spent
true